Because some of Jesus’ warnings in Luke 12 are so stark, it is easy to read them in a purely negative light. Some teachings are for the close disciples of Jesus and some for the crowd of thousands who have gathered. We do well to note this context as we read. This passage is when things begin to get serious. Following Jesus in the first few years of the movement is not going to be easy and may cost many their lives. Are they willing?
